summ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orVladimir Vukicevic <vladimir@pobox.com>2007-10-02 10:54:44 -0700
committerCarl Worth <cworth@cworth.org>2007-11-26 21:24:48 -0800
commit198dc3573f2a80accd1ba0c188ea5378f5f99bc5 (patch)
treefc26eb9298f7df6968586cc95545ee77d9d0b081
parentbf67f28746044b6d5a712921c617ba52d31d33e3 (diff)
[win32] return a nil surface, not NULL
Missed an error return (cherry picked from commit c99d33b10e84883ade1402c3c1d1efdb4b46f66e)
-rw-r--r--src/cairo-win32-surface.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/cairo-win32-surface.c b/src/cairo-win32-surface.c
index 5c9d7d8f..f1a87035 100644
--- a/src/cairo-win32-surface.c
+++ b/src/cairo-win32-surface.c
@@ -1762,7 +1762,7 @@ cairo_win32_surface_create_with_ddb (HDC hdc,
HBITMAP saved_dc_bitmap;
if (format != CAIRO_FORMAT_RGB24)
- return NULL;
+ return NIL_SURFACE;
/* XXX handle these eventually
format != CAIRO_FORMAT_A8 ||
format != CAIRO_FORMAT_A1)